Extreme Weather Continues to Wreak Havoc in China

Epoch Video

Torrential rains and massive hail storms have destroyed houses, cars, roads and crops all over China. In addition to the Yangtze River region, Yunnan Province in the south and Inner Mongolia in the north were both inundated in floodwater on July 2.